From the clamor of bygone parades to the phantom scent of burned rubber on Route 66, ghoulish and supernatural visions flourish in Bloomington-Normal. Claimed by a devastating fire in 1859, the spirit of a young girl haunts Kelly''s Bakery. Visitors to Kemp Hall report seeing the specter of a lady in red. Cantankerous pitcher Charles "Old Hoss" Radhourn trolls Evergreen Memorial Cemetery. Author Deborah Carr Senger embarks on a tour of Bloomington-Normal''s haunted heritage. Less
